CVE-2019-19532 comprises multiple out-of-bounds write vulnerabilities in Linux kernel HID, including force-feedback, drivers before Linux kernel 5.3.9. The affected drivers insufficiently validate metadata supplied while a USB HID device is attached, allowing a malicious USB device to cause writes outside intended memory bounds. The upstream correction is identified as CID-d9d4b1e46d95; supported vendor kernels may contain the fix as a backport despite retaining an earlier base-version string.
